Krouse points to a great article by Simon Willison who proposes that the killer role for vibe coding (hopefully) will be to make code better and not just faster.

By generating prototypes that are based on different design models each end product can be assessed for specific criteria like code readability, reliability, or fault tolerance and then quickly be revised repeatedly to serve these ends better. No longer would the victory dance of vibe coding be simply "It ran!" or "Look how quickly I built it!".

As a former PM, I will say that if you want to stop something from happening at your company, the best route is to come off very positive about it initially. This is critical because it gives you credibility. After my first few years of PMing, I developed a reflex that any time I heard a deeply stupid proposal, I would enthusiastically ask if I could take the lead on scoping it out. I would do the initial research/pl…

Very well said. So many engineers balk at "coming off as positive" as a form of lying or as a pointless social ritual, but it's the only thing that gets you a seat at the table. Engineers who say "no" or "that's stupid" are never seen as leaders by management, even if they're right. The approach you laid out here is how you have _real_ impact as an engineering leader, because you keep getting a seat at the table to steer what actually happens.
